“Watters is a reliable pro-Trump voice from the conservatives.” This is what the ‘New York Times’ writes about the successor to Tucker Carlson who was fired in April at the right-wing American news channel Fox News. So Jesse Watters takes Carlson’s place.

Watters is known for getting noticed. With populist statements, with racially motivated questions, with its anti-corona measures. In 2021, Watters ranted against immunologist Anthony Fauci, explaining to his conservative viewers at a conference how to ambush him using investigative techniques.

Jesse Watters made his debut on Tuesday evening, following in Carlson’s footsteps for the first time and hosting his first primetime show on Fox News. In which he was promptly reprimanded. And by none other than his mother.

“We have a very special guest on the phone. A Democrat – my mother. Hello mom,’ Watters greets his guest on the phone. He asks her how she’s liked the show so far, and she responds positively. “I want to congratulate you baby – we are so proud of you and your achievements. And you worked so hard. Now let’s make sure you keep your job,” she says.

Jesse Watters’ mother hates Donald Trump

Watters laughs – apparently because he doesn’t know what to expect next.

Because so that her son can keep his job, Watter’s mother has brought a few suggestions. Quite a list, she admits. “Don’t get involved in conspiracy theories,” she says tough. The moderator laughs again. Interestingly, Anne Watters, Jesse’s mother, is a staunch Democratwho was written about in 2018 as disliking then-President Donald Trump.

Anne Watters continues: “We don’t want to lose you and we don’t want to be sued.” Then she really gets to work.

«In line with the Hippocratic oath: do no harm. We want you to be kind and respectful. You said yourself that humility is a strength. Use your voice responsibly to foster conversation that has a common thread.» Here the moderator begins to massage his forehead somewhat nervously.

But Anne Watters goes even further: “There has really been enough Biden bashing (…). For example, maybe you could suggest that your people be less interested in and talk about other people’s bodies.”

Here, however, Watters intervenes. Because apparently his mom is talking about a post that ran on the show earlier. A post that pursues the agenda of far-right Republicans and incites against the LGBTQIA+ community.

“Wait a minute,” says the moderator, cutting off his mother’s words. “We’re trying to keep other people’s interest away from children’s bodies — that was the point of this post.”

Apparently it gets too colorful for him, he tries to silence his mother. But she won’t let it go that easily. “Wait, wait, wait,” she says. “I want you to look for solutions instead of fanning the flames.”

Jesse Watters simply says, “I knew it was a bad idea.”

Of course, it’s safe to assume that this was all a brazen PR stunt by Watters and his producers. But whether the strategy really turned out as hoped is at least doubtful.
